Abstract
A direct current power server configured to serve a direct current microgrid of a building. The direct current power server includes a direct current bus having branch circuits that extend from the direct current power server to provide direct current power to direct current loads of the building. The direct current power server directly integrates a local energy source and local energy storage into the direct current microgrid without attachment to the alternating current electrical grid.
